Скопируйте файл на гугл диск через cron - PullRequest
0 голосов
/ 28 сентября 2018

Я пытаюсь создать задание cron (в Ubuntu), которое сохраняет файл на диск Google.

Итак, я создал папку test прямо в / и поместил туда файл some.txt.Затем следующий текст был добавлен в crontab (sudo nano /etc/crontab)

3,13,18,23,33,43,53 * * * * root gdrive upload -r /test/some.text -p googleDiskFolderId

В /var/log/systemlog Я вижу только следующую информацию:

Sep 28 00:03:01 bizon4ik-X555UB CRON[9755]: (root) CMD (   gdrive upload -r /test/some.txt -p googleDiskFolderId)
Sep 28 00:03:02 bizon4ik-X555UB CRON[9754]: (CRON) info (No MTA installed, discarding output)

Однако файл не отображается вдиск Google.

Я подумал, что, возможно, проблема в конфигурации диска Google, но sudo gdrive upload -r /test/some.txt -p googleDiskFolderId отлично работает для меня.

gdrive скрипт находится в /usr/bin, и этот путь присутствуетв $PATH

У вас есть идеи, где я ошибся?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...